Subject: [PATCH 09/11] transport-pci: Describe PCI MMR dev config registers


Legacy virtio configuration registers and adjacent
device configuration registers are located somewhere
in a memory BAR.

A new capability supplies the location of these registers
which a driver can use to map I/O access to legacy
memory mapped registers.

This gives the ability to locate legacy registers in either
the existing memory BAR or as completely new BAR at BAR 0.

A below example diagram attempts to depicts it in an existing
memory BAR.

+\subsubsection{Transitional MMR Interface: Legacy Memory Mapped Configuration Registers Capability}
+\label{sec:Virtio Transport Options / Virtio Over PCI Bus / Virtio Structure PCI Capabilities / Transitional MMR Interface: Legacy Memory Mapped Configuration Registers Capability}
+
+The optional VIRTIO_PCI_CAP_LEGACY_MMR_CFG capability defines
+the location of the legacy virtio configuration registers
+followed by legacy device specific configuration registers in
+the memory region BAR for the transitional MMR device.
+
+The \field{cap.offset} MUST be 4-byte aligned.
+The \field{cap.offset} SHOULD be 4KBytes aligned and
+\field{cap.length} SHOULD be 4KBytes.
+
+The transitional MMR device MUST present a legacy configuration
+memory mapped registers capability using \field{virtio_pcie_ext_cap}.
